POV: Add primitives workspace tools icons, blurry reflections, equation based isourface ; various fixes
* fix tiny formatting of quotes, docstrings, parenthesis
* fix pov centered worspaces
* fix (revert) bad default for text block insertion
* fix primitive exports sorted by most frequent for (slight) speed up
* fix some uninitialized hairstrand root diameter variable
* fix extracted function for CSG inside vector
* fix too big size of proxy mesh for ininite plane caused it to blink
* fix end of render speach error handling
* fix max specular value to better map out under a texture influence
* fix emit, ambient, translucency shading properties UI broken post 2.8
* add workspace tools icons for pov primitives
* add a user input equation based isosurface primitive
* add micro normals based blurry reflections (glossy UI slider)
